DESCRIPTION;ENCODING=QUOTED-PRINTABLE:David Asher Rotsztain is an organic farmer, goatherd and farmstead cheese maker on the Gulf Islands of British Columbia. A guerrilla cheese maker, David explores traditionally cultured, non-corporate methods of cheese making. Though mostly self-taught, he picked up his cheese skills from various teachers, including a Brown Swiss cow named Sundae on Cortes Island.=0D=0A=
=0D=0A=
David offers cheese outreach to communities through cheese making workshops in partnerships with food-sovereignty-minded organizations all across North America, including The UBC Farm. His workshops teach a cheese making method that is natural, DIY, and well suited to any home kitchen. David has been teaching cheese making for over seven years.=0D=0A=
